Understanding Color Psychology in Interior space
The psychology of color profoundly impacts the feel and mood within interior spaces, molding how occupants perceive and interact with a given surrounding. Understanding this aspect is crucial for effective Interior Design, as color choices can create art emotional responses and functional perceptions. For instance, in a residential interior design project, warm colors like reds and oranges in a kitchen might encourage appetite and energy, whereas cool blues and greens create a calming effect in an apartment bedroom. Thoughtful color application is an fundamental element of Interior Design for any house, villa, or even a compact studio.
Professionals in commercial interior design employ color psychology to enhance productivity or guide customer behavior within a space. Bright, vibrant hues can energize a retail environment, while muted, refined tones art an air of professionalism to an office. The meticulous selection of a color palette in Interior Design establishes not just the aesthetic but the entire user experience within any given interior architecture.

Various lighting techniques and their outcomes
Potent lighting techniques profoundly influence the atmosphere and functionality of any interior design project, shaping perceptions of space, materiality, and finishes. Thoughtful interior design integrates ambient, task, and accent lighting to create layered illumination, enhancing features like polished marble surfaces or rich wood cabinetry. This strategic approach lifts both the aesthetic and practical aspects of decorating interiors, highlighting architecture and decorative arts for a cohesive interior decor.

Sustainable approaches that shape interior design
Sustainable practices in Interior Design prioritize environmental responsibility and occupant well-being. This focus involves sourcing eco-friendly materials and incorporating elements like biophilic design to connect inhabitants with nature, enhancing both health and productivity within an Interior Design project. Many contemporary interior design approaches, including minimalism, often accept sustainability naturally.
Implementing sustainability in Interior Design also extends to energy efficiency, waste reduction, and promoting circular economy principles. Biophilic design, for example, might include a garden or natural light in a healthcare setting to improve recovery. This devotion to sustainability shapes responsible Interior Design, whether for residential or commercial spaces.
